Output d3ecbda38acf95296bccb0208abe40d0da3df0af28ab26b4ae48c6832f69c5cd:12

value
568246
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6ec43804d963f58f41467b77cef08f393232b62 OP_EQUAL
address
3QCdBd2tzdbL392qK3KiJmgvXUGz5mKt6X
transaction
d3ecbda38acf95296bccb0208abe40d0da3df0af28ab26b4ae48c6832f69c5cd
spent
true